Robert Englund who played Freddie Kruger in the popular horror A Nightmare on Elm Street is going to film a new screen version of Nikolai Gogol’s The Vij in Italy.
The first movie after the same-name classic horror story by Nikolai Gogol was produced in the USSR in 1967, turning into a blockbuster that attracted 32.6 million viewers only in 1968. It has been many times mentioned as the first and the only horror movie made in the USSR, though its authors had intended to create a romantic fairy tale and a screen version of a classic.
It is not the first time that Robert Englund is going to be a film director. Earlier he directed the films 976-EVIL and Killer Pad, rus.postimees.ee informs.
The production of The Vij remake will be launched in 2009.
